PATIENT's Health Care Act of 2013

Introduced 2013-07-15· Sponsored by Rep. Ross, Dennis A. [R-FL-15]· House

[AI summary unavailable — showing source text] Providing Accountability and Transparency to Incentivize Economically Necessary Transitions in Health Care Act of 2013 or the PATIENT's Health Care Act of 2013 - Amends the Internal Revenue Code, with respect to health savings accounts (HSAs), to: allow a new tax deduction for premiums paid for a high deductible health care plan; repeal the requirement that an individual making a tax deductible contribution to an HSA be covered by a high deductible health care plan; increase the maximum HSA contribution level; allow Medicare beneficiaries to contribute to an HSA; allow a rollover of HSA amounts to a Medicare Advantage Medical Savings Account (MSA); allow a transfer of a flexible spending arrangement balance to an HSA upon separation from employment; allow payments of high deductible health plan premiums from HSAs; repeal the prohibition against payment of over-the-counter drugs from HSAs, Archer MSAs, and health flexible spending and reimbursement arrangements; allow payment of long-term care premiums from health flexible spending arrangements; allow a rollover of Archer MSA and HSA amounts to adult children of an account holder; allow a carryover of up to $500 of unused health ben…
